@spendguard/vercel-ai

Vercel AI SDK middleware for Agentic SpendGuard budget guardrails. Drop-in via wrapLanguageModel({ model, middleware: createSpendGuardMiddleware(...) }) on any @ai-sdk/* provider — pre-call budget reservation before the upstream provider HTTP call fires, end-of-stream commit reconciles real token usage, signed audit trail. Transitively covers Mastra Agents via the @spendguard/vercel-ai/mastra subpath alias.

What it does

Vercel AI SDK v4+ (ai) is the dominant TS-side LLM router. Mastra Agents call generateText / streamText from ai underneath, so a single middleware covers both ecosystems.

@spendguard/vercel-ai ships a LanguageModelV1Middleware factory — createSpendGuardMiddleware — that you drop onto any @ai-sdk/* provider via wrapLanguageModel({ model, middleware }). No model subclassing, no proxy fork. The Mastra subpath (@spendguard/vercel-ai/mastra) re-exports the same factory under the Mastra-idiomatic name createSpendGuardLanguageMiddleware — strict function-reference equality holds.

Install

pnpm add @spendguard/sdk @spendguard/vercel-ai ai

@spendguard/sdk, ai (Vercel AI SDK), and zod are declared as peer dependencies so the adapter pins none of them — your project's lockfile wins. Node 20.10+ is required.

For real provider HTTP, add the official @ai-sdk/* provider you target:

pnpm add @ai-sdk/openai     # or @ai-sdk/anthropic, @ai-sdk/google, ...

Quick start

import { generateText, wrapLanguageModel } from "ai";
import { openai } from "@ai-sdk/openai";
import { SpendGuardClient } from "@spendguard/sdk";
import { createSpendGuardMiddleware } from "@spendguard/vercel-ai";

const client = new SpendGuardClient({
  socketPath: "/var/run/spendguard/adapter.sock",
  tenantId: "00000000-0000-4000-8000-000000000001",
  runtimeKind: "vercel-ai-js",
});
await client.connect();
await client.handshake();

const middleware = createSpendGuardMiddleware({
  client,
  tenantId: "00000000-0000-4000-8000-000000000001",
  budgetId: "44444444-4444-4444-8444-444444444444",
});

const model = wrapLanguageModel({
  model: openai("gpt-4o-mini"),
  middleware,
});

try {
  const { text } = await generateText({ model, prompt: "hello vercel ai" });
  console.log(text);
} finally {
  await client.close();
}

For the Mastra-side import:

import { createSpendGuardLanguageMiddleware } from "@spendguard/vercel-ai/mastra";

Same factory. Same options surface. Strict === equality with the root export.
